How to fill out over-dispersed and zero-inflated models

How to fill out over-dispersed and zero-inflated models
01
Step 1: Collect the data on the dependent variable and the independent variables.
02
Step 2: Determine if the data is over-dispersed or zero-inflated by examining the distribution.
03
Step 3: If the data is over-dispersed, use a negative binomial regression model to account for the extra variability.
04
Step 4: If the data is zero-inflated, use a zero-inflated model to account for the excess zeros.
05
Step 5: Fit the selected model to the data using statistical software.
06
Step 6: Interpret the results and draw conclusions based on the model output.
07
Step 7: Assess the goodness-of-fit of the model to ensure its adequacy.

What is over-dispersed and zero-inflated models?
Over-dispersed and zero-inflated models are statistical models used to analyze data where the data exhibit more variation (over-dispersion) or more zeros (zero-inflation) than would be expected from a standard probability distribution.
